متن کاملSuccessful Treatment of Nocardia Farcinica Prosthetic Valvular Endocarditis without Valvular Replacement
We report a case of prosthetic valve nocardia endocarditis. A 43 year old farmer underwent aortic valve replacement with a bioprosthetic valve. The immediate post-operative course was uneventful but 2 weeks later he developed fever. A trans-oesophageal echocardiogram (TEE) showed a string like structure attached to the prosthetic valve. متن کاملProsthetic Valve Endocarditis
In 38 cases of prosthetic valve endocarditis, 19 were early cases (onset < 60 days after insertion of prosthesis) and 19, late cases (onset> 60 days). Nine late cases had onsets 12 to 53 months after surgery.
